Zink Power Clucker is a great call. Surprisingly versatile for an inexpensive call. Fast clucks and moans are easy with the Zink.

Quackhead (RNT) Goozilla is also a really good one. However, it takes a little more air to run it than the Zink.

If I were picking one, it would be the Zink. I have never had trouble getting it retuned after cleaning it. Just put the reed back the way it was when you took it apart and make tiny, tiny, adjustments to its position if it sounds off.
